Transaction 42f0fc9d76558a24fa44afe80176ebb4c20550e9bb65932180010c984c67b181

20 Input
2 Outputs
  • 42f0fc9d76558a24fa44afe80176ebb4c20550e9bb65932180010c984c67b181:0
  • value  52791676
    address  34dDKqPSRZQTeyAWMk1TuYGAcwS7YDJqRn
  • 42f0fc9d76558a24fa44afe80176ebb4c20550e9bb65932180010c984c67b181:1
  • value  4698113
    address  334TEtk1iw7dxoPDfEohEQTorNYwPk8kCL